Which of the following Non invasivemethod is used in detecting position of the tubes in ventilation

Correct Answer: Capnograph
Description: (Capnograph): (192- Davidson 21st edition)CAPNOGRAPHY - The CO2 concentration in inspired gas is zero, but during expiration-after clearing the physiological dead space. It rises progressively to reach a plateau which represents the alveolar or end tidal CO2 concentration. This cyclical changes in CO2 concentration or Capnogram is measured using an infrared sensor inserted between the ventilator tubing and the endotracheal tube. In normal lungs, the end tidal CO2 closely mirrors Paco2 and can be used to assess the adequacy of alveolar ventilation. However its use is limitedas there may be marked discrepancies in lung disease or impaired pulmonary perfusion (eg due to hypo volaemia) In combination with the gas flow and respiratory cycle data from ventilator. CO2 production and hence metabolic rate may be calculated.In clinical practice end tidal CO2 is used to confirm correct placement of an endotacheal tube, in the management of head injury, and during the transport of ventilated patients.
